Elon Musk has made financial history by becoming the world’s first trillionaire

South African-born entrepreneur Elon Musk has made financial history by becoming the world’s first trillionaire, following the sensational initial public offering (IPO) of his aerospace and technology company, SpaceX, on the Nasdaq stock exchange.

 

The company’s shares skyrocketed during their trading debut, closing nearly 20% above the initial offering price. This massive surge pushed the total market valuation of the rocket, satellite, and artificial intelligence firm well beyond the two-trillion-Dollar mark, instantly multiplying Musk’s personal fortune to unprecedented levels.

 

While SpaceX firmly dominates global satellite internet through its Starlink network and commands the commercial rocket launch sector, financial analysts warn that the company’s staggering new valuation is highly speculative. Market experts point out that the current share price relies on immense expectations for the firm’s unproven artificial intelligence division, which has yet to demonstrate a commercial or technical edge over established artificial intelligence (AI) market leaders like OpenAI and Anthropic.

 

The historic share float has generated billions in fresh capital, which Musk intends to channel into capital-intensive, frontier projects. These include building next-generation orbital data infrastructure and accelerating his long-term ambitions for deep-space exploration.
